1

5 Essential Elements For Google Reviews

News Discuss 
All this means you ought to do your best to get your delighted consumers to leave 5-star Google reviews with your Google Company Profile. If, Alternatively, you experienced a adverse knowledge, your Google critique could just be what will save others their precious money and time on anything you believe https://google-reviews14578.thenerdsblog.com/39969773/the-ultimate-guide-to-google-reviews

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story